Understanding Defense Methods
Comprehending the various protection approaches your attorney could employ is vital to efficiently browsing your situation. visit the following internet page depends upon the specifics of the fees you're encountering and the proof versus you. Let's explore what you require to understand.
First off, if there's an absence of evidence, your legal representative might argue that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your job to show innocence; it's the district attorney's job to verify shame past an affordable question. If they can not, you ought to be acquitted.
An additional common strategy is self-defense, especially in cases involving fees like attack or murder. If you were safeguarding on your own, your lawyer may use this technique to justify your activities lawfully. This requires showing that your assumption of danger was reasonable which your reaction was proportional to that hazard.
Sometimes, your defense could involve questioning the legality of just how proof was obtained. If law enforcement breached your legal rights during the examination, proof might be reduced, which can substantially deteriorate the prosecution's case.
Ultimately, your attorney could bargain an appeal offer if it serves your best interest. This generally happens if the evidence versus you is strong yet there are reducing elements that could lead to lowered fees or sentencing.
Comprehending these approaches aids you review your instance more effectively with your attorney.
